## Overview

DAP 271 Weldwood Original Contact Cement is a premium, brush-grade neoprene adhesive designed for professional-grade bonding. It dries quickly within 15-20 minutes, creating a durable, water- and heat-resistant bond ideal for wood, leather, rubber, paper, and plastic laminates. Trusted for over 15 years, it exceeds industry standards and is perfect for high-strength, long-lasting repairs and woodworking projects.

## Description

Product Description Premium quality, brush grade, neoprene-based contact cement that meets the stringent requirements of the professional user. High strength and initial grab make it ideal for most projects. Fast-drying formula dries in 15-20 minutes. Offers high heat and water resistance when dry. Exceeds industry performance requirements. Review: worked very well with adding veneer to our mid-century dresser - I got this Dap Weldwood Original Contact Cement 00271 to attach a paper-backed veneer to the top of our old American of Martinsville dresser that's been in my family since the 1960s that had gotten water damaged (from potted plants sitting on it). We think it was made in the 1950s. I tried refinishing the dresser top, but the thin veneer top had lifted, cracked, & chipped in one 5" area-there was just no way to fix it well enough to not look obvious, so I decided we should re-veneer the top. I wasn't sure what type of wood veneer it was, so I checked online for the different types of wood grain veneers and narrowed it down to Cherry that I would stain (it could also be walnut, but the cherry was a closer match unstained...and better price! LOL) I used this Weldwood Contact cement on a portion of a 2'x8' roll of paper-backed cherry veneer from desertcart. The dresser is just over 4' long & 21" deep so we've got extra for a future project [https://smile.desertcart.com/Cherry-Veneer-Plain-Sliced-Sheet/dp/B009KN8INE/ref=sr_1_3?ie=UTF8&qid=1535399026&sr=8-3&keywords=cherry+veneer] After I filled in the missing veneer sections of the dresser with bondo & my husband sanded the top, we cut the veneer to size with a 1/2" extra edge all around & glued it to the dresser top with this Dap Weldwood Contact Cement (I rolled the glue onto both surfaces as seen in the first photo-the dresser top had a darker stain on it because I had first tried to repair it unsuccessfully). This Weldwood Contact Cement is strong stuff. Once it's stuck on...it's permanent. So when the contact cement was just "tacky" on both surfaces, we laid down square wood rods across the surface of the dresser and laid the veneer on top of that. Starting at one end, we pulled out each rod as we pressed the veneer onto the dresser. We let it rest for over a week with a lot weight on top, which included several heavy books & round weights evenly distributed. Note: you can use clamps, but for us, books and weights were definitely sufficient for this Weldwood Contact Cement-our clamps would have been difficult to evenly distribute pressure since the dresser is completely enclosed on the back & sides. Before placing the books, I covered the veneer with white butcher paper-wax side up to protect the surface from scratches, dirt, etc. After a week, we removed the weights & books-the veneer is perfectly flat!-trimmed off the edge & lightly sanded the top & edges to get ready to stain. To match the aged appearance of the dresser, I brushed one coat of Minwax Polyshades Mission Oak...left it on for about 5 minutes, then wiped it off (see photo attached). ## Questions & Answers

**Q: How much area does a point cover? Using for laminate counter tops**
A: Goes a long way with one coat. I covered an area 24 inches x 18” and had 3/4 of the can left over.

**Q: do these work on rubber/leather shoe midsole and outsole?**
A: Half the sole on my work sneakers was falling off and I glued it back on with this following the directions on the can and it's still on there after months. The sole on the other shoe did the same thing so now they're both glued. I glued the bezel back on my watch with this too and it's been on there for over a year and I wear it 24hr/day. It's pretty good stuff. Just make sure whatever you glue is mostly clean and it'll really stick.
